Transaction 720a18152e60d958885dbdff1d7d74c67cd957578daf08522badd24c39caef83
1 Input
1 Output
-
720a18152e60d958885dbdff1d7d74c67cd957578daf08522badd24c39caef83:0
- value
- 52730263
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3d3abf8fab61b610fd7d2a55ec0c41dbe65aa6a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PEEmpyE3qVdRpsPtVw5oWjfnzdKcy1SVE